| Abstract | Sugarcane mosaic disease (SMD) caused by the Sugarcane mosaic virus (SCMV), Sorghum mosaic virus (SrMV) and Sugarcane streak mosaic virus (SCSMV) and sugarcane yellow leaf disease (SYLD) caused by the Sugarcane yellow leaf virus (SCYLV) are the two most prevalent and economically important viral diseases of sugarcane. In this study, a one-step quadruplex reverse transcription (RT)-PCR method that employed virus-specific primers was developed for the simultaneous detection and differentiation of SCMV, SrMV, SCSMV and SCYLV. Several sets of primers for each target virus were evaluated for their sensitivity and specificity by simplex and quadruplex RT-PCR. The optimum primer combinations and concentrations, RT temperature and time, and PCR annealing temperature and extension time were determined for the quadruplex RT-PCR. The assay was then validated using sugarcane samples affected with SMD and/or SYLD collected from sugarcane breeding fields and farmers' fields in southern China. |
